mysql怎么查询和更新数据

PHPz
PHPz 原创
2023-04-21 13:59:58 1780浏览

Mysql是一种关系型数据库管理系统,广泛应用于服务器端的数据存储和查询。在实际的应用中,经常需要通过mysql进行数据查询和更新。本文将从查询和更新两个方面介绍Mysql的基本用法和注意事项。

一、Mysql查询

Mysql的查询语句主要包括select和from两个关键字。其中select表示需要查询的字段和表达式,from表示查询的数据表,具体语法如下:

select field1, field2, ..., fieldN from table_name where condition;

其中,field1, field2, ..., fieldN表示需要查询的字段列表,可以使用通配符*代表所有字段。table_name表示数据表名称,condition表示查询条件,可以使用关键字and, or等组合多个条件。

例如,查询一个学生表的所有记录可以使用如下语句:

select * from student;

查询学生表中姓名为张三的记录可以使用如下语句:

select * from student where name='张三';

查询学生表中年龄大于18且性别为男的记录可以使用如下语句:

select * from student where age>18 and gender='男';

在查询过程中,还可以使用聚合函数count, sum, avg等获取统计信息,例如:

select count(*) from student;

上述语句可以统计学生表中记录的总数。

二、Mysql更新

Mysql的更新语句主要包括update和set两个关键字。其中update表示需要更新的数据表,set表示需要更新的字段和值,具体语法如下:

update table_name set field1=value1, field2=value2, ... where condition;

其中,table_name表示需要更新的数据表名称,field1, field2, ...表示需要更新的字段列表,value1, value2, ...表示需要更新的值,condition表示更新条件。

例如,将学生表中年龄小于等于18岁的学生的成绩更新为60分可以使用如下语句:

update student set score=60 where age<=18;

在更新过程中,需要注意以下事项:

  1. 使用where条件可以限制更新的记录范围,避免误操作。
  2. 更新前需要备份数据,并进行测试验证。
  3. 在更新时需要注意数据一致性和存储效率。

三、总结

Mysql是一种强大的关系型数据库管理系统,提供了丰富的查询和更新功能。在使用Mysql时,需要注意语句的语法和操作的安全性。希望本文的介绍可以为Mysql的使用者提供一些参考和帮助。

以上就是mysql怎么查询和更新数据的详细内容,更多请关注php中文网其它相关文章!

声明:本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系admin@php.cn核实处理。